Developer’s Description

Visualize explicit functions, parametric systems, and surfaces with a mathematical function viewer.
Zhu3D for openSUSE (32-bit) is an interactive OpenGL-based mathematical function viewer. You can visualize explicit functions, parametric systems, and ISO surfaces. The viewer supports zooming, scaling, and rotating as well as filed lighting or surface properties. Special effects are animations, transparency, textures, fog, and motion blur. Equation systems can be solved with a fast adaptive search. Zhu3D for openSUSE (32-bit) provides you with up to eight background settings, lights, wire-modes, or illumination models. For picture rendering and textures all common formats are recognized. User-defined functions can have any amount of parameters, can be nested or recursive. For special purposes if-clauses and Boolean operators are supported. ISO surfaces can use different volume-based algorithms.
